  1. given $overline{ab}paralleloverline{cd}$, prove that $mangle1 + mangle2 + mangle3=180$.

Explanation:

Step1: Use alternate - interior angles

Since $\overline{AB}\parallel\overline{CD}$, $\angle2$ and $\angle4$ are alternate - interior angles. So, $m\angle2 = m\angle4$.

Step2: Consider the straight - line angle

$\angle1$, $\angle3$, and $\angle4$ form a straight - line. The sum of angles on a straight - line is $180^{\circ}$. So, $m\angle1 + m\angle3+m\angle4=180^{\circ}$.

Step3: Substitute $\angle4$ with $\angle2$

Substitute $m\angle4$ with $m\angle2$ in the equation $m\angle1 + m\angle3+m\angle4=180^{\circ}$. We get $m\angle1 + m\angle2 + m\angle3=180^{\circ}$.

Answer:

The proof is completed as shown above, and $m\angle1 + m\angle2 + m\angle3 = 180^{\circ}$.
